Advertisement
-Annie-

EXAM-PROBLEM-01.SweetDesert

Jul 4th, 2017
74
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
  1. function solve(input) {
  2.     let ivanchosChash = Number(input[0]);
  3.     let numberOfGuests = Number(input[1]);
  4.     let bananasPrice = Number(input[2]);
  5.     let eggsPrice = Number(input[3]);
  6.     let berriesPrice = Number(input[4]);
  7.  
  8.     let sets = Math.ceil(numberOfGuests / 6);
  9.     let bananas = sets * (2  * bananasPrice);
  10.     let eggs = sets * (4  * eggsPrice);
  11.     let berries = sets * (0.2  * berriesPrice);
  12.  
  13.     let total = bananas + eggs + berries;
  14.     total = total.toFixed(2);
  15.     let neededMoney = total - ivanchosChash;
  16.     neededMoney = neededMoney.toFixed(2);
  17.  
  18.     if(total <= ivanchosChash) {
  19.         console.log(`Ivancho has enough money - it would cost ${total}lv.`);
  20.     } else {
  21.         console.log(`Ivancho will have to withdraw money - he will need ${neededMoney}lv more.`);
  22.     }
  23. }
  24.  
  25. solve(['20',
  26.     '33',
  27.     '0.60',
  28.     '0.50',
  29.     '10']);
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ement